Early Life

Chinsea Linda Lee (Shenseea) was born on October 1, 1996, in Mandeville, Jamaica. She has Jamaican ancestry from her mother's side and Korean origin from her father's.

Her mother died in 2020, and she had never met her father, as he left her mom when she was six months pregnant with Shenseea.[1]

As a child, she sang in the church choir in her hometown and was a fan of Michael Jackson and Whitney Huston. Her first stage performance was when she was eight years old.[2]

Regarding her education, she attended Mena High School and has a college degree in Entertainments Management.

Before starting her artistic career, Shenseea worked as a party promo girl.

Career development

Before officially swimming into the music industry, Shenseea was dipping her feet in the singing waters by posting covers of herself on her social media channels.

Her boss saw her videos, noticed her talents, and suggested a singer-manager collaboration.

In an interview for Breakfast Club Power 105.1 FM, she revealed that the collaboration was based on mutual trust.[3]

After releasing her first song, "Jiggle Jiggle," in 2016, her career took off, leading to a collaboration with Vybz Kartel. Together, they released "Loodi," officially launching her into the music industry.

In 2017, she was featured in Sean Paul's song "Rolling," which received more than five million views.

In 2019, Shenseea signed with Interscope Records and released the song "Blessed" featuring Tyga.

In addition to successful collaborations with other rappers, she was featured in Christina Aguilera's album "Liberation."

Shenseea also released numerous successful solo singles that hit more than ten million views on YouTube. Among her most famous songs are: "Forplay," "Love I got for You," "Pon mi'," and "Trending Gyal."

In 2021, she collaborated with Kanye West on a song called "Ok ok pt 2." This song got her nominated for "Album of the Year" at the 2022 Grammy Awards.

At the beginning of 2022, Shenseea dropped "Lick" along with Megan Thee Stallion. The song was an immediate hit and received 16 million views.

Additionally, Shenseea released the songs "Lying if I call it Love" and "Light my Fire," featuring Gwen Stefani and Sean Paul.

When Shenseea released her first album, "Alpha," in March 2022, it sold 4,900 album-equivalent units in the first week. [4]

Personal Life

Shenseea has a son named Rajeiro Lee, whom she gave birth to when she was twenty years old.

There were rumors that the singer was dating Drake; however, she denied those rumors.

Although she confirmed that she is dating someone, the person's identity has not been revealed.[5]
